Ex-Ambassador to Malaysia Azimbek Beknazarov disagrees with dismissal

Ex-Ambassador of Kyrgyzstan to Malaysia, Azimbek Beknazarov, does not agree with his dismissal. He announced it at a press conference.

«I learned from the media that by presidential decree I was relieved of my post for not coping with the assigned duties. I demanded from the Ministry of Foreign Affairs to name the reason why they removed me, they gave me an answer only in August. However, there is no motivation part. I have not a single reprimand, not a single admonishment or warning,» Azimbek Beknazarov said.

He believes that he worked quite effectively. In particular, he tried to bring investors into the country, and wrote to the Prime Minister about this more than once, spoke to the President. However, no response was received.

«I met with Sadyr Japarov, talked about Sary-Dzhaz deposit that Malaysian investors were ready to mine tin there. The President said that he supported this idea, but nothing was done in the end. In addition, I made repairs at the Embassy of Kyrgyzstan, we bought furniture and carpets, I bought paintings. It was a shame to invite someone there,» the former diplomat added.

Azimbek Beknazarov was dismissed from the post of Ambassador of Kyrgyzstan to Malaysia. According to the press service of the head of state, the decision was made due to the fact that he could not cope with the set foreign policy tasks, including strengthening the political dialogue between Kyrgyzstan and Malaysia.
